§ 29-22C-23 — Complimentary service, gift, cash or other item

(a)No racetrack table games licensee may offer or provide any complimentary service, gift, cash or other item of value to any person unless:
(1)The complimentary consists of room, food, beverage or entertainment expenses provided directly to the patron and his or her guests by the racetrack table games licensee or indirectly to the patron and his or her guests on behalf of the licensee by a third party;
(2)The complimentary consists of documented transportation expenses provided directly to the patron and his or her guests on behalf of a racetrack table games licensee by a third party, provided that the licensee complies with the rules promulgated by the commission to ensure that a patron's and his or her guests' documented transportation expenses are paid for or reimbursed only once;
